Python Programming: An Introduction to Computer Science, 3rd Ed.
3rd Edition
ISBN: 9781590282755
Author: John Zelle
Publisher: Franklin, Beedle & Associates
expand_more
expand_more
format_list_bulleted
Concept explainers
Expert Solution & Answer
thumb_up100%
Chapter 1, Problem 2MC
Program Description Answer
Hence, the correct answer is option “D”.
Expert Solution & Answer
Want to see the full answer?
Check out a sample textbook solutionStudents have asked these similar questions
It was designed to compute mathematical tables to automate a standard procedure for calculating the roots of polynomials.
Choices:
A) Abacus
B) Napier's Bone
C) Hollerith's Punched-Card
D) Difference Engine
E) Analytical Engine
F) Jacquard's weaving loom
G) MARK I
H) ENIAC
I) EDVAC
J) UNIVAC I
K) Leibniz's Calculator
Part 6: Boolean Logic Expressions
Boolean expressions are types of logical operations that we can perform on true and false values. Note that the word Boolean is always capitalized because it was named after its inventor, George Boole. Boolean algebra is a very important topic in computer science, and if you haven't learned it before you definitely will in the future. However, for our purposes we are only interested in how we can use them to manipulate binary numbers. The way we use them on binary numbers is by treating 1 as true and 0 as false. From this point on I will be using 0 and 1 instead of false and true.
There are many types of Boolean expressions, but the three most important ones are AND, OR, and NOT.
AND takes 2 operands and will output 1 if they are both 1, or 0 otherwise
OR takes 2 operands and will output 1 if either one is 1, or 0 if neither is 1
NOT takes 1 operand and reverses it: 1 becomes 0, and 0 becomes 1
We can represent this behavior using something called a…
Select all the statements that are true
Select all the statements that are true
Algorithms solve problems
Algorithms always finish
Algorithms are general solutions
Algorithms were created to help computers solve problems
Algorithms each consist of a single step to be taken or action to be performed
Chapter 1 Solutions
Python Programming: An Introduction to Computer Science, 3rd Ed.
Ch. 1 - Prob. 1TFCh. 1 - Prob. 2TFCh. 1 - Prob. 3TFCh. 1 - Prob. 4TFCh. 1 - Prob. 5TFCh. 1 - Prob. 6TFCh. 1 - Prob. 7TFCh. 1 - Prob. 8TFCh. 1 - Prob. 9TFCh. 1 - Prob. 10TF
Ch. 1 - Prob. 1MCCh. 1 - Prob. 2MCCh. 1 - Prob. 3MCCh. 1 - Prob. 4MCCh. 1 - Prob. 5MCCh. 1 - Prob. 6MCCh. 1 - Prob. 7MCCh. 1 - Prob. 8MCCh. 1 - Prob. 9MCCh. 1 - Prob. 10MCCh. 1 - Prob. 1DCh. 1 - Prob. 2DCh. 1 - Prob. 3DCh. 1 - Prob. 4DCh. 1 - Prob. 5DCh. 1 - Prob. 1PECh. 1 - Prob. 2PECh. 1 - Prob. 3PECh. 1 - Prob. 4PECh. 1 - Prob. 5PECh. 1 - Prob. 7PE
Knowledge Booster
Learn more about
Need a deep-dive on the concept behind this application? Look no further. Learn more about this topic, computer-science and related others by exploring similar questions and additional content below.Similar questions
- It uses a punched card's, which were also used in the early electronic computers. Choices: A) Abacus B) Napier's Bone C) Hollerith's Punched-Card D) Difference Engine E) Analytical Engine F) Jacquard's weaving loom G) MARK 1 H) ENIAC I) EDVAC J) UNIVAC K) Leibniz's Calculatorarrow_forwardQuestion 4 - Algorithm Design Imagine you are a treasure hunter standing at one side of the river. There are n (a positive integer) stones on the river. They are aligned on a straight line and at the nth stone, there is treasure waiting for you. Your target is to reach the nth stone. For each move, you have the choice of either walking (move one stone ahead) or leaping (move two stones ahead). Also, you are not allowed to travel backwards. Design an algorithm that calculates the number of ways (sequences of walks/leaps) that get you to the treasure stone. You should clearly explain the algorithm and demonstrate the correctness of the algorithm with a complete proof. Here is an example. For n = 1 5, there are 8 ways: Method 1: walk → walk → walk → walk → walk Method 2: walk → walk → walk → leap Method 3: walk → walk → leap → walk Method 4: walk → leap → walk → walk walk Method 5: leap → walk → walk → Method 6: leap → leap walk Method 7: leap → walk → leap Method 8: walk → leap leaparrow_forwardThis device was used the US Bureau of Census in 1880's. Choices: A) Hollerith's Punched-Card B) Difference Engine C) Analytical Engine D) Jacquard's weaving loom E) MARK I H) ENIAC I) EDVAC J) UNIVAC I K) Leibniz's Calculatorarrow_forward
- Computer Science sort a list of 1000 numbers, i have to make it in pseudocode, can you help me? Pleasearrow_forwardWhat does it mean when someone tells you, in reference to computing, to "resist the urge to code"?arrow_forwardIt uses the binary system for encoding and entering data. Choices: A.) Abacus B) Napier's Bone C) Hollerith's Punched-Card D) Difference Engine E) Analytical Engine F) Jacquard's weaving loom G) Mark 1 H) ENIAC I) EDVAC J) UNIVAC I K. Leibniz's Calculatorarrow_forward
- Fibonacci numbers are the numbers in a sequence in which the first three elements are 0, 1, and 1, and the value of each subsequent element is the sum of the previous three elements: 0,1,1,2,4,7,13,24...arrow_forward8) A special value used to indicate “end of data entry" is called a a...... or a value. Answer: 9) A . is a graphical representation of an algorithm. Answer: Page 2 of 9arrow_forwardComputer Science How to write an essay onTreaps data structure(Just need points for each paragraph).arrow_forward
- explain and prove the algorithm You found a lost civilizations' library and you are interested in its alphabet of 7 strange characters. Each book has a title in this alphabet and you hope that the books are arranged in lexicographical order on the bookshelves. You would like to know whether the order of the books uniquely determines the order of the characters of the alphabet, or if there is insufficient information, or whether even such an order cannot exists (meaning that someone must have shuffled the books). Think of the input as a list of words without spaces from the alphabet "a-z", and the question is the order of the characters "a-z" in the examined alphabet. Try to find an algorithm which solves this problem in time linear in the size of the input (that is, the number of characters on input). You may assume that each character appears at least once. Don't assume that the size of the alphabet is a fixed constant (like 26); treat it as a variable n, and let L be the total number…arrow_forwardComputation theory The study of computers When compared to passing by value, what are the advantages and disadvantages of passing by reference?arrow_forwardXBRL "facts," "ideas," and "taxonomies"arrow_forward
arrow_back_ios
SEE MORE QUESTIONS
arrow_forward_ios
Recommended textbooks for you
- Enhanced Discovering Computers 2017 (Shelly Cashm...Computer ScienceISBN:9781305657458Author:Misty E. Vermaat, Susan L. Sebok, Steven M. Freund, Mark Frydenberg, Jennifer T. CampbellPublisher:Cengage LearningC++ for Engineers and ScientistsComputer ScienceISBN:9781133187844Author:Bronson, Gary J.Publisher:Course Technology Ptr
Enhanced Discovering Computers 2017 (Shelly Cashm...
Computer Science
ISBN:9781305657458
Author:Misty E. Vermaat, Susan L. Sebok, Steven M. Freund, Mark Frydenberg, Jennifer T. Campbell
Publisher:Cengage Learning
C++ for Engineers and Scientists
Computer Science
ISBN:9781133187844
Author:Bronson, Gary J.
Publisher:Course Technology Ptr
Computational Software for Intelligent System Design; Author: Cadence Design Systems;https://www.youtube.com/watch?v=dLXZ6bM--j0;License: Standard Youtube License